Give it a chance to work. It takes a few weeks to kick in, and even then the Dr. may want to adjust the dosage. I take Celexa, among other things, and it helped pull me out of a severe depression that had me hospitalized last summer. I also take an antipsychotic at a low dose to augment my anti-D's & find that it makes a big difference.

Hang in there and give the meds a chance to work.
